I agree that these are incredibly comfortable seats, better than most vehicles I've owned and certainly more comfortable than any aircraft seats I've ever sat in. That said, I have bad knees and a bad back so I'm often a little uncomfortable after a longer stint behind the wheel. For me, that's true of any vehicle though.

One thing I did recently that I've found helpful, is to save two different seat positions so I can easily vary my position. Position 1 has me sitting fairly high and upright (generally my preferred position when driving a truck/SUV). Position 2 has me sitting a little lower and more reclined. With the memory seats, you can get multiple positions nicely dialed in (including pedals, steering wheel, mirrors and seat) and easily toggle between them to reduce fatigue. You can't recall a different position with the vehicle in drive, but if you bump it into neutral then press the memory recall button, you can shift back into drive while the seat is still moving.
